TIPS TO PREPARE FOR 12TH CBSE PHYSICS Some of the Tips to prepare for physics which might help you for your preparation are as follows.... -> REFER PREVIOUS YEAR PAPERS : As you have not mentioned the board i have attached the 12th CBSE board physics model papers in this post for your reference.... -> Just go through the model papers and try to find out the important questions which are asked for the exam frequently and prepare for those questions first and then move on to other questions... -> PREPARE A SCHEDULE : As you have only 5 months to prepare its very much needed to prepare a proper schedule and go with the schedule for eg. take one small lesson each day and try to finish it for the day... this will surely help you out to prepare properly in 5 months time... -> WORK HARD : This is last and most important thing which you have to follow daily i.e to work hard, there is no one in the world who have achieved success without this important quality... so for this 5 months keep aside all things around you and concentrate only on your studies then for sure you will come out with flying colors.. ![]() -> I have also attached some of the other tips which is very much needed when you are preparing for your final exam.. just go through it once...
